## Authentication

Heads up: the nightly reindex job (`reindex_nightly.py`) talks to the Lanternfish search cluster, and that cluster won't accept anonymous writes anymore — we locked it down last sprint. The job now authenticates as the `reindex-runner` service identity against Corvid Gateway, and the token is injected via the `LF_INDEX_TOKEN` env var in the scheduler config. Nothing clever going on, just a bearer header on every batch request. For review purposes, the staging credential currently in use is listed below.

service key, kadug-kadup: kto15_rN23XLAYImmZgrJ

Welcome aboard! The Hallowgate Museum audio-guide app won't boot on staging because the env file got mangled last sprint. I've fixed the stream host and locale flags already. The narration service still rejects requests, though, since its access token is missing — please paste it on the line immediately following this sentence.

env line for fafof-fahag: LEDGER_TOKEN5=f8790

- [ ] Mail room has moved. It's no longer on Level 1 at Harkwell House — now Basement B2, past the loading corridor. Collect your starter pack there, not from reception. Internal post trays moved too; outgoing mail cut-off is now 15:00. If your desk delivery hasn't arrived by day two, raise it with the Porterage desk, not IT. The B2 corridor door is badge-locked at all times. Use the pass code below to get through.

turnstile pass: bdg-MWRUHE-76377440